Voting alignment

Gareth Bacon and Ms Stella Creasy voted the same way 3% of the time, based on 1,182 shared comparable votes.

37 same votes 1,145 different votes 1,182 shared votes

Alignment only includes divisions where both MPs recorded an Aye or No vote. Tellers, absences, abstentions, and missing votes are excluded.
